Stone the Crows - legendary singer's still gigging after 50 incredible years:

In the 70s, she toured with Led Zeppelin at the personal request of mates Robert Plant and Jimmy Page.

So when the band reformed in 2007 to play a tribute gig for her mentor, the late Ahmet Ertegun - boss of Atlantic Records - they invited Maggie to take part. She wowed 20,000 fans at the O2 Arena in London with a rousing version of Do Right Woman, Do Right Man - a hit for Aretha Franklin in 1967.

Maggie, 64, recalled: "I had not seen Robert or Jimmy for nearly 25 years and was thrilled to be asked.

"I walked up to Jimmy in the dressing room - wearing glasses and with my hair tied up - and said, 'Bet you don't remember me' "And he said, 'Hello Maggie'. We all look totally different now.

"I met Oasis, U2 and Paolo Nutini at the gig and had a great night. They knew my music and that shocked me.

"The Led Zeppelin reunion was a blast ... but all too quick. It's something which will never happen again and that's a wee bit sad."
